Since each of the first 3 quarters can use a maximum of 27% of EB visas available, then a minimum of 19% of 158k should be left for Q4 (July-September) or 30k.
Only looking at that Q4 number, midway through July should have about 25k left.
But that would only be the case if all available visas had been used in the first 3 quarters.
On the basis that spillover yet to be released to EB2-I may be 14-15k, then the expected number left should be 10-15k higher than expected, as other Categories would have to have underused by that amount in the first 3 quarters.
In addition Q4 has to have sufficient visas (more than normal) for EB3-WW. They certainly underused as the existing inventory ran out and new applications awaited adjudication.
On that basis, 29k left look a very low figure. I would expect it to be over 40k.
